- 670 名前:仕様書無しさん mailto:sage [2008/01/05(土) 14:30:12 ]
- >>669
シングルトンだって引数から渡さずにどこからでもアクセスできちまうだろ? ヘッダさえインクルードしてありゃどっからでも呼び出せる グローバル変数が駄目だって言われる最大の理由は変更箇所がわからないからだぜ //引数有り(関数の中でポインタpD3DXを使用してなんらかの処理をしていることがわかる) unko(pD3DX); //引数無し(関数の中を見ないと何をやって何にアクセスしているかわからない) unko(); ↑これが最大の問題点 一般的に関数に必要なものは関数の引数、戻り値ですべてわからなければならないとされている で、なければ仕様書に入力、出力を書くことができない ってことを最近知らない奴が掲示板に増えてきてておっさんの俺は悲しい限りだ グローバル変数がなんで駄目なのか知らないのが多いんだよね
|

|